Almost every vegetarian dish I eat contains cheese or eggs.
The exception is curry. I recommend you familiarise yourself with Indian veggie food because it's good shit. Lentil dahls, aubergine curry, vegetable biryani etc
Vegan for about 6 years.
Recent cookbooks I can recommend to you:
The Seitanic Spellbook
The Make Ahead Vegan Cookbook
Isa Does It
Just start going through and cooking one or two recipes a day. See what you like.
